A foundation established in loving memory.

Dr. Zahurul Huq, MD

(1933 – 2017)

From humble beginnings, Dr. Zahurul Huq embarked on a lifelong journey to help people and ease their suffering – both in his professional life and personal life. He supported himself through medical school and rigorous advanced training to become a masterful surgeon. His training took him to the UK and the U.S. He eventually settled in the U.S. Along the way, he fostered many meaningful relationships.

About

Part of his life’s mission was to contribute to helping and advancing humanity. He believed in the power of education, and firmly believed that women ought to have access and opportunities just like their male counterparts to attain an education. He had a profound respect for those who work hard, especially to ethically help themselves to make the world a better place, help their family and community.

He often worked on surgical cases on a sliding fee scale and a pro bono basis. He believed in helping the Bangladeshi community become stronger through strong connections and weaving culture, talent, and support. Whether it was supporting Bangladeshi culture, banding people together to help an individual or family in need, or finding resources to help an individual or family with their plight, he was ready to go that extra milefor the betterment of the community, family, or individual. He had a vision of Bangladeshis working with each other and outside the community to make a positive impact on humanity.
